The Job:  

As a Director of Product Information Management (PIM), you’ll be part of our Corporate Information Technology team working as a Hybrid employee.   We are seeking an experienced and strategic Director of PIM to lead and scale our product data operations. This role is responsible for ensuring accurate, consistent, and high-quality product information across all customer touchpoints and business systems. The ideal candidate will establish robust data governance practices, align cross-functional teams, and drive automation and efficiency in product onboarding and enrichment processes.

In addition to operational leadership, this role will focus on building and developing a high-performing team, fostering professional growth, and creating a collaborative culture centered on innovation, ownership, and continuous improvement. By making product data a strategic business asset, the Director of PIM will help accelerate product launches, enable personalization, and improve customer experiences—ultimately fueling business growth and operational excellence.

Key Responsibilities:

Strategic Leadership:

Define and lead the enterprise-wide PIM strategy aligned with business objectives.Position product data as a key enabler of digital transformation and scalable growth.Serve as a trusted advisor to executive leadership on product data initiatives and investments.

Team Leadership & Development:

Build, lead, and mentor a high-impact PIM team, including data managers, analysts, and assets specialists.Set clear goals, provide regular feedback, and support professional development plans.Foster a team culture of accountability, innovation, knowledge sharing, and continuous learning.Collaborate with HR and leadership to attract, retain, and grow top talent.

Data Governance & Quality:

Establish standards, policies, and governance frameworks for product data quality, taxonomy, and classification.Drive data consistency, accuracy, and completeness across all systems and channels.Ensure compliance with regulatory requirements and internal policies.

Operational Excellence:

Streamline product onboarding and enrichment workflows to reduce time-to-market.Lead initiatives to automate data management processes and reduce manual effort.Collaborate with business partners to ensure seamless integration between PIM
and other systems (Bynder DAM and Drupal CMS).

Cross-Functional Alignment:

Work closely with Product, Marketing, Merchandising, and Master Data teams to align on data needs and priorities.Provide strategic oversight and direction to cross-functional data stewards and PIM users.Foster a culture of collaboration and data ownership.

Customer Experience & Personalization:

Support digital initiatives by delivering clean, enriched product data for omnichannel experiences.Enable advanced personalization, filtering, and search capabilities through structured product information.Help drive data-driven marketing and merchandising decisions.

Analytics & Continuous Improvement:

Monitor product data performance using KPIs and analytics tools.Identify and implement opportunities for continuous improvement in data processes and system capabilities.Stay ahead of industry trends and emerging technologies in data management and digital commerce.

The Person:  

You love to learn and grow and be acknowledged for your valuable contributions. You’re not intimidated by innovation. Wouldn’t it be great if you could do your job and do a world of good? In fact, you embrace it. You also have:  

Bachelor's or Master’s Degree in Library or Information Science, Data Management,
or a related field.8+ years of experience in PIM, MDM, or digital product content management, including 3+ years in a leadership role.Proven experience with PIM platforms (e.g., Salsify, Akeneo, Riversand, or similar).Strong understanding of product data architecture, data governance, and systems integration.Experience working in a multichannel or global product data environment.Excellent leadership, communication, and cross-functional collaboration skills.Strong analytical, strategic thinking, and change management abilities.
